Written by the company

We are a UK market-leading education, skills, and training provider, delivering Further and Higher Education, apprenticeships and adult-skills funded courses to 16+ year olds nationwide. We are Education, Done Differently. Our mission is to create a legacy in the communities we serve, and our vision is to positively impact on the lives of 1 million young people and adults.
